Jose Luis Perez, a 50-year-old Hialeah man, has been arrested in connection with a series of package thefts at a Miami condominium complex. The thefts occurred between Feb. 16 and Feb. 23 at the building located at 1900 N. Bayshore Dr. and were reported to the building's package room supervisor. Police then reviewed surveillance footage after receiving multiple complaints about missing packages. Video shows several orange Amazon delivery bags left outside the package room because it was full. While being processed at the Turner Guilford Knight Correctional Center, officers found a baggie containing suspected cocaine in Perez's pocket. He is facing charges including burglary of an unoccupied structure, petit theft between $150 and $750, and introduction or possession of a controlled substance.
